Department of Homeland Security Awarded a Contract to SIGMA ASSESSMENT SYSTEMS INC for $321,537.00
Signed on
9/26/2024, 12:00 AM
SIGMA ASSESSMENT SYSTEMS INC Government Contract #70FA4024P00000066
SIGMA ASSESSMENT SYSTEMS INC was awarded a contract with the United States Government for $321,537.00. The contract was awarded by the agency office SUPPORT SERVICES SECTION(SS40), which is a division with the Federal Emergency Management Agency within the Department of Homeland Security.
Summary of Award
The US federal government awarded a contract to Sigma Assessment Systems Inc for a training program participant assessment. The total obligation for the contract is $60,000, with the base exercised options also amounting to $60,000. The total account outlay and obligation are both $60,000. The contract was signed on September 26, 2024, and the period of performance is from September 26, 2024, to September 25, 2025, with a potential end date of September 25, 2029.
The contract falls under the category of a purchase order, with the product or service code being "U008" and the NAICS code being "611430" for professional and management development training. The contract was not competed, with only one source being used for the solicitation procedures. The contract was not set aside for any specific group, and there was no preference used in the evaluation process. The contract was awarded by the Department of Homeland Security, specifically the Federal Emergency Management Agency, under the Support Services Section (SS40).
Sigma Assessment Systems Inc, the recipient of the contract, is a U.S.-owned business located in Guaynabo, Puerto Rico. They specialize in education and training, specifically in training and curriculum development. The company is categorized as a corporate entity, not tax-exempt, and a limited liability corporation. The contract transactions include three actions: one on September 26, 2024, for the initial transaction amount of $60,000, and two modifications on February 27, 2025, and April 2, 2025, with no transaction amounts specified.
